Ex Reject Shop chief to take helm of Tahbilk Group

(Source: Tahbilk)

Former CEO and MD of The Reject Shop, Ross Sudano, has been appointed as the new CEO of Tahbilk Group, the first person outside the family to hold the role. 

Sudano will succeed incumbent, fourth-generation Alister Purbrick, who will retire this June. 

“After 43 years running my family businesses, Tahbilk and the Tahbilk Group, it’s time for me to pass the baton on,” said Purbrick. 

As the new CEO of Victoria’s oldest family-owned winery, Sudano will report to the board and oversee the group’s operations based in the Nagambie Lakes region of Victoria. He will also be based at Tahbilk’s corporate office in Melbourne. 

Prior to Tahbilk, Sudano held several CEO positions across a range of industries, including at BP Australia and Foodland Associated Limited. In his recent role as CEO and MD of The Reject Shop, Sudano oversaw a strategic realignment, and successes included reducing the cost of business over his five-year tenure, generating $24 million per annum in savings alone. 

“We are certain that his extensive and proven business acumen and leadership skills will build on the successes achieved over 162 years of operation.”
